#7ef10e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7ef10e is composed of 49.4% red, 94.5%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.2%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 90.4 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 50%. #7ef10e color hex could be obtained by blending #fcff1c with #00e300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

● #7ef10e color description : Vivid green.
The hexadecimal color #7ef10e has RGB values of R:126, G:241,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 8319246.
